Review this Python function and identify all issues: ```python def get_cat_ages(cats): ages = [] for i in range(len(cats)): if cats[i]["age"] > 0: ages.append(cats[i]["age"]) else: ages.append("unknown") return sum(ages) / len(ages) ``` List each bug, explain why it's a problem, and provide a corrected version.
